There is no direct connection from Livermore to Los Gatos. However, you can take the train to Santa Clara Station, walk to Santa Clara Transit Center, take the line 60 bus to Winchester Station, then take the line 27 bus to Santa Cruz & Los Gatos-Saratoga.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Livermore Transit Center to Los Gatos-Saratoga & University via Dublin/Pleasanton BART Unloading, Dublin / Pleasanton, Bay Fair, Berryessa / North San Jose, Berryessa BART, and Good Samaritan Hospital in around 3h 51m.
